What size hole in tire can be repaired?

Punctures can be repaired if the hole is a quarter-inch across or less. Some manufacturers may also say a tire should be repaired no more than twice or prohibit repairs if two punctures are within 16 inches of one another. More serious damage to a tire, such as gashes or long cuts, cannot be repaired.29 Aug 2015

How much does it cost to fix a hole in a tire?

On average, tire puncture repair will cost you between $10 and $20. The repair will involve getting the tire patched. Some tire dealers will repair a punctured tire for free if you purchased your tire from them.16 Feb 2012

When can a tire not be patched?

Puncture repairs are limited to the center of the tread area. If there are punctures or damage in the shoulder or sidewall of the tire, it is not repairable.

How do you fix a punctured tire hole?

- Remove tire from the rim. - Thorough inspection of both the inside and outside of the tire. - Once deemed repairable, trim the puncture area of damaged cables to clean and stabilize the area. - From the inside out, pull a rubber stem through the puncture area sealing off the inside of the tire.

How long can you drive on a patched tire?

On average, tire experts predict that a proper plug and patch can last from seven to ten years. Although tire patches can last a long time, a tire should never be patched more than once. It can negatively affect the speed rating and potentially cause blowouts.5 Feb 2018
